Swedish Women’s Educational Association Michigan
Rooted in Detroit, Michigan since 1991, the Swedish Women's Educational Association Michigan represents a vibrant community of approximately 60 women united by a shared appreciation for Swedish heritage and culture. Founded by Tottie Samuelsson, this non-profit organization welcomes women of all ages and backgrounds—many with Swedish as their mother tongue, though membership extends far beyond native speakers to anyone passionate about Swedish traditions. SWEA Michigan distinguishes itself as part of the world's largest network dedicated to preserving Swedish language and cultural practices outside of Sweden itself. The organization transcends typical networking by creating a strong personal support system among members while simultaneously strengthening connections between Swedish professionals and industries abroad. Operating as a trusted community institution, SWEA Michigan serves an important function within the Swedish Ministry of Foreign Affairs' international support structure. Members gather regularly for cultural events, educational programs, and social activities that celebrate Swedish traditions while building lasting friendships across the Detroit community. The organization's reach extends globally, with SWEA chapters in numerous countries, yet its heart remains firmly rooted in serving the Detroit area's Swedish and Swedish-heritage population. For women seeking authentic cultural connection, professional networking opportunities, and a welcoming community that honors Swedish traditions, SWEA Michigan provides an invaluable resource and gathering place in the greater Detroit region.
German Professional Women's Association
Based in Lake Orion, MI, the German Professional Women's Association (GPWA Inc.) is a mission-driven organization dedicated to serving the business and cultural interests of German-speaking women throughout the United States. Founded on the principle of mutual support and community connection, GPWA creates a welcoming forum where professional women can gather, share experiences, and strengthen their careers together. The organization stands out for its dual commitment to both professional advancement and cultural preservation, recognizing that German-speaking women professionals benefit from spaces that honor their linguistic and cultural identity. GPWA's core values center on collaborative support for career and education development, creating opportunities for meaningful business and social relationships, and fostering understanding across cultural boundaries. Members find in GPWA a unique community that celebrates their background while providing practical assistance for professional growth. The association's approach emphasizes reciprocal support, where experienced professionals mentor emerging leaders and all members contribute to a collective knowledge base. By bringing together German-speaking women from diverse industries and backgrounds, GPWA Inc. builds bridges between cultures while strengthening professional networks. The organization's commitment extends beyond networking to include cultural education and cross-cultural competency development, helping members thrive in increasingly global professional environments. For German-speaking women professionals in the Lake Orion, MI region and beyond, GPWA Inc. represents more than an association—it's a community dedicated to empowering women through connection, understanding, and shared purpose.
